Nov 14, 2019 · The data rate of a network connection is normally measured in units of bits per second, generally abbreviated as bps instead of b/s. Network equipment manufacturers rate the maximum network bandwidth level their products support using the standard units of Kbps, Mbps, and Gbps.

Dec 29, 2016 · What does 10Base-T Mean? Dec 29, 2016. This is an Ethernet standard that is designed to transmit data at the rate of 10Mbps over a twisted pair cable. You can also get broadband plans with faster speeds than that, but they generally cost a Q: What does 150 Mbps and 300 Mbps Routers mean? A: 150 Mbps and 300 Mbps means the maximum wireless links speed the router can provide. It is the internal WLAN connection speed between the computer and the router, not the internet speed. What does this mean? Well, that means that internet plan has a download speed of 5 mbps and an upload speed of 1 mbps. The reason why your upload and download speed are different is because most internet connections are asymmetric. In English this means that the bandwidth is a different size going one way compared to the other.
